Steampunk Books Coming Out in December 2012

At the start of each month, the fine folks over at SF Signal compile an awesome list of science fiction, fantasy, and horror (and thereabouts) books coming out in the next month. Here are the Steampunk (and related) books from their lists for December, but please look at the full list too if you are looking for something outside of our little fiefdom.

The Bookman Histories by Lavie Tidhar
The Bookman Histories by Lavie Tidhar, Angry Robot, December 26 (Omnibus of The Bookman, Camera Obscura, and The Great Game.)
The Doctor and the Rough Rider by Mike Resnick
The Doctor and the Rough Rider by Mike Resnick, Pyr, December 4
Doktor Glass by Thomas Brennan
Doktor Glass by Thomas Brennan, Ace, December 31

Fungi Anthology
Fungi edited by Silvia Moreno-Garcia and Orrin Grey, Innsmouth Free Press, December 1 (Not Steampunk per se, but contains works by Steampunk writers Jeff VanderMeer and Lavie Tidhar.)
Gilded by Karina Cooper
Gilded: The St. Croix Chronicles by Karina Cooper, Avon, December 26
The League of Illusion: Legacy by Vivi Anna
The League of Illusion: Legacy by Vivi Anna, Carina Press, December 31
Nell Gwynne's On Land and At Sea
Nell Gwynne’s On Land and At Sea by Kage Baker and Kathleen Bartholomew, Subterranean, December 31
The Steam Mole by Dave Freer
The Steam Mole by Dave Freer, Pyr, December 4
Touch of Steel: A Novel of the Clockwork Agents by Kate Cross
Touch of Steel: A Novel of the Clockwork Agents by Kate Cross, Signet, December 4
